Summary

On 21 May 1965 at about 12:15 local time, a Beechcraft 35-B33 registered N8910M, operated by Capitol Aviatn, was involved in an accident during the landing phase of flight near MacOmb Ill, Illinois, United States. 2 people were on board and nobody was injured. The aircraft was substantially damaged. No probable cause statement is available for this record.
